We are seeking a creative and relationship-driven Influencer Relations Specialist with a passion for digital storytelling to drive Kobo’s brand presence and ethos. This key role reports to the Senior Manager, social media, and will be responsible for developing and executing a robust influencer strategy that deeply resonates with the bookish communities online. The Specialist will own the end-to-end influencer program lifecycle, from sourcing and contracting to coordinating with content creators and agencies. This is an exciting opportunity to cultivate authentic partnerships, provide data‑driven recommendations, and significantly contribute to Kobo's brand growth and influence among avid readers.
Owned by Tokyo‑based Rakuten and headquartered in Toronto, Rakuten Kobo Inc. is one of the most advanced global ecommerce companies, with the world’s most innovative e‑reading services offering more than 6 million eBooks and audiobooks to 30 million+ customers in 190 countries. Kobo delivers the best digital reading experience through creative innovation, award‑winning e‑readers, and top‑ranking mobile apps. Kobo is a part of the Rakuten group of companies.
